Chlorosis is very commonlymet with among the daughters <strong>of</strong> a tuberculous mother.SymptamH and Course. A number <strong>of</strong> observations haveestablished the fact that the number <strong>of</strong> blood-corpuscles is verymuch less in the blood <strong>of</strong> chlorotic patients ; in very deepcases this number is diminished by four-fifths <strong>of</strong> the normal quanWe do not know what the cause <strong>of</strong> this deficiency is, but thisdeficiency accounts for most <strong>of</strong> the symptoms <strong>of</strong> the disease. Itgenerally commences very slowly. <strong>The</strong> patients become more irritable, they are apt to get tired after every little eiFort ; theyliable to changes <strong>of</strong> color ; the skin soon loses its bright lustrthe patients complain <strong>of</strong> feeling chilly at an early period <strong>of</strong> thedisease. Inasmuch as the pathological picture which now developsitself, may be characterized by a variety <strong>of</strong> symptoms, we preferdescribing the derangements as they appear in each special organand system.<strong>The</strong> skin at times has the color <strong>of</strong> wax; at other times it is rathyellowish or <strong>of</strong> a dingy-white, the veins being either not at allbut indistinctly perceptible. <strong>The</strong> color <strong>of</strong> the cheeks may changequite <strong>of</strong>ten within a very brief period <strong>of</strong> time. <strong>The</strong> visible mucoumembranes are more or less without color. (Edematous symptomsonly occur in the highest grades <strong>of</strong> the disease, and excite a suscion that some other disease is at the bottom <strong>of</strong> these symptoms.<strong>The</strong> following symptoms occur in the digestive range : Impairedappetite, aversion to meat, longing for strange articles <strong>of</strong> diet,as vinegar, chalk, coiFee-beans ; bloating <strong>of</strong> the stomach after emeal, acidity <strong>of</strong> the stomach, generally the bowels are very torpiIn the nervous system we discover excessive irritability, neuralghysteric symptoms, fitful mood. — <strong>The</strong> breathing is accelerated;the least physical eftbrt causes an attack <strong>of</strong> dyspnoea, sometimesa very high degree. <strong>The</strong> circulation is accelerated, very seldomretarded ; disposition to transitory palpitations <strong>of</strong> the heart whare easily excited by a physical eftbrt; anjeraic murmur in the lveins <strong>of</strong> the neck. <strong>The</strong> menses are irregular, sometimes entirelysuppressed or very tardy, sometimes more pr<strong>of</strong>use than usual, butalways <strong>of</strong> a lighter color or even quite colorless.
